Ingredients
– 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
– 1 cup long-grain white rice
– 2 cups chicken broth
– 1 cup heavy cream
– 1 medium onion, chopped
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 teaspoon paprika
– 1 teaspoon dried thyme
– 1 teaspoon salt
– ½ teaspoon black pepper
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– Fresh parsley for garnish (optional)
Step-by-Step Instructions
Creating Creamy Creamy Smothered Chicken and Rice is a straightforward process. Follow these simple steps to ensure success:
1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
2. Sear the Chicken: In a large oven-safe sk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per. Sear them for 4-5 minutes on each side until browned.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
3. Sauté the Aromatics: In the same skillet, add the chopped onion and minced garlic. Sauté for about 2-3 minutes until the onion is translucent.
4. Add the Rice: Stir in the long-grain white rice and cook for an additional minute, allowing it to toast slightly.
5. Combine Liquids: Pour in the chicken broth and heavy cream. Add paprika and thyme, stirring to combine all ingredients well.
6. Return the Chicken: Place the seared chicken breasts back into the skillet, ensuring they are nestled into the rice and sauce mixture.
7. Bake: Cover the skillet with a lid or aluminum foil and transfer it to the preheated oven.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the rice is tender and the chicken is cooked through.
8. Rest: Once out of the oven, let the dish rest for 10-15 minutes. This helps the flavors meld and allows the rice to absorb any remaining liquid.
9. Garnish and Serve: Before serving, garnish with fresh parsley for a pop of color and added flavor.

Additional Tips
– Use Fresh Ingredients: Fresh herbs and quality chicken can enhance the flavor of your Creamy Creamy Smothered Chicken and Rice.
– Adjust Consistency: If the sauce is too thick, add a little more chicken broth or cream to achieve your desired consistency.
– Spice it Up: For those who enjoy a kick, consider adding a pinch of cayenne pepper or a splash of hot sauce to the creamy sauce.
– Serve with a Side: A simple green salad or garlic bread pairs wonderfully with this dish, enhancing the overall meal experience.
– Experiment with Cheese: Mixing in some shredded cheese during the last few minutes of baking can create an even creamier texture and rich flavor.

Freezing and Storage
– Storage: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It should stay fresh for about 3-4 days.
– Freezing: This dish freezes well. Portion it into containers and freeze for up to 3 months. When ready to eat, thaw in the refrigerator overnight and reheat on the stove or in the oven.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use brown rice instead of white rice?
Yes, but note that brown rice requires a longer cooking time. Adjust the liquid and cooking time accordingly.
What can I use instead of heavy cream?
You can substitute with half-and-half or a non-dairy cream alternative, but the richness may be different.
Is this dish suitable for meal prep?
Absolutely! It stores well and can be reheated easily, making it perfect for meal prep.
Can I cook this on the stovetop instead of baking?
Yes, you can cover and simmer on low heat instead of baking. Just ensure the rice is fully cooked.
How do I know when the chicken is cooked through?
The internal temperature should reach 165°F (75°C). A meat thermometer is helpful for accuracy.
